
Acorn Squash is a winter squash which means it's grown in the summer like summer squash, but harvested in the late summer and fall. Acorn squash can be grown in winter as well, making it available all year.
Acorn squash is a small, ribbed squash, shaped like an acorn. They are usually blackish-green or yellow. Acorn squashes will keep for about a month when stored cool.
Seasonality
Northern Hemisphere from September - December
Southern Hemisphere from March - June
